Responsibilities and Duties

OCT Consulting LLC is recruiting on behalf of a federal client for a Lead Supply Chain Specialist who will

serve as the subject matter expert on medical device supply chain management and provide authoritative, sound, and evidence-based information to the senior officials to ensure the sustained availability of medical devices during times of calm and public health emergencies, both natural and man-made.

The following are typical duties and responsibilities of the Lead Supply Chain Specialist:

  • Provide leadership, oversight, and coordination for the Center in matters relating to availability of medical devices and their supply chains.
  • Support champions in the management of initiatives through leadership, meeting management, and project management, including risk management.
  • Utilize expert supply chain and logistics knowledge, risk mitigation expertise, and scientific and regulatory experience to collaboratively advance the RSCP’s medical device supply chain program and serve as an expert on the Center’s cross-functional supply chain team to address challenges to assure safe and effective medical devices are broadly available.
  • Evaluate the causation of various supply chain shocks and develop and share mitigation strategies across the Center and Agency, as well as with industry, suppliers, contract manufacturers, distributors, and other stakeholders to stem potential disruptions.
  • Provide leadership to cultivate formal and informal partnerships with medical device manufacturers, suppliers, carriers, scientific associations, organizations, and societies, patient-focused, foreign stakeholders, to include international producers and government entities, and other U.S. government officials at the federal, state, and local levels regarding supply chain concerns and regulatory impact of disruptions.
  • Counsel and train members of the team, explain critical and significant supply chain and technology concepts, establish methodologies, procedures, guidelines, and policies.
  • Lead the timely analysis, solution development, and resolution of newly identified issues
  • Draft recommendations to address supply chain vulnerabilities and risks, that could lead to potential disruptions
  • Collaborate with colleagues to continuously evaluate the performance and impact of the Center’s supply chain program and research new and emerging technologies to enhance data collection
  • Draw upon Center experts' comprehensive knowledge of medical devices, product history, and related matters to anticipate and identify supply chain issues, and to ensure that the project team is aware of these problems and addresses them
  • Explore and develop new ways of resolving issues and building consensus among appropriate subject matter experts, managers, and where appropriate, industry officials, and external professional association representatives; ensures that these issues are identified across the Center are addressed in a timely and effective manner.
  • Conduct expert technical reviews of precedent-setting professional studies, research, and/or analysis
  • Help support the development of policy around supply chain oversight
  • Interpret and apply existing policy, setting precedents that affect internal and industry program activities and the supply chain of regulated products
  • Compare and contrast current and proposed policies to formulate strategies for CDRH to effectively address medical device supply chains
  • Lead the development of supply chain visualizations for a wide range of medical device products to determine the vulnerabilities, risks, alternative products, and potential mitigations.
  • Work with manufacturers to extract supply chain data and conduct supply chain network analytics, putting different data together and extracting insights from data from multiple sources.
